BEFORE: D. CHIPMAN, MEMBER
Tuesday the 8th day of April, 2025
THIS MATTER having come before the Tribunal;
AND THE TRIBUNAL having been advised by the Parties on April 4, 2025, that a full uncontested settlement had been reached, on consent;
THESE MATTERS involving appeals under 34(11) and s. 51(39) of the Planning Act, R. S.O. 1990, c. P. 13, as amended, regarding the refusal of the Town of Oakville with respect to applications for a Zoning By-Law Amendment and Draft Plan of Subdivision concerning the lands located at 304 and 318 Spruce Street having come before the Tribunal to consider a settlement proposal proffered on consent of the Parties on April 4, 2025;
AND THE TRIBUNAL having received and considered:
i. the uncontested opinion evidence of Paul Lowes, a Registered Professional Planner, a member of the Ontario Professional Planners Institute and Canadian Institute of Planners, in his Affidavit sworn on April 2, 2025;
ii. The Exhibits contained therein.
AND THE TRIBUNAL, having accepted the uncontradicted Affidavit evidence of Paul Lowes, with respect to the Zoning By-law Amendment (“ZBA”) and Draft Plan of Subdivision (“PoS”) before the Tribunal in relation to lands known municipally as 304 and 318 Spruce Street in the Town of Oakville (“Subject Property”), and finding that the proposed ZBA and PoS, along with the prescribed conditions are consistent with, conform to, and are in keeping with applicable policies and guidelines of the Province of Ontario and the Town of Oakville, including:
i. the Planning Act;
ii. the Provincial Planning Statement 2024;
iii. the Region of Halton Official Plan;
iv. the Town of Oakville Official Plan;
AND THE TRIBUNAL finding that the requested ZBA and PoS, as revised pursuant to the settlement agreement, meet the required legislative tests, represent good planning, are in the public interest, and warrant approval, in principle, subject to the conditions agreed to by the Parties as set out in (Attachment 4);
AND THE TRIBUNAL, finds that it is satisfied that the proposed settlement along with prescribed conditions and revised instruments giving effect thereto:
a. have appropriate regard for matters of provincial interest under s. 2 of the Planning Act, in particular by optimizing the use of existing land and infrastructure within a settlement area;
